Basic Air Fryer Breakfast Recipes
Now that we’ve covered the benefits of cooking breakfast in an air fryer, let’s move on to some basic recipes to get you started.
Scrambled Eggs
Scrambled eggs are a breakfast staple, and they’re incredibly easy to make in an air fryer. Here’s a simple recipe to try:
- Crack 2-3 eggs into a bowl and whisk them together. Add a splash of milk and a pinch of salt and pepper to taste.
- Pour the egg mixture into a greased air fryer basket.
- Cook the eggs at 300°F (150°C) for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Bacon
Crispy bacon is a breakfast favorite, and it’s easy to make in an air fryer. Here’s how:
- Line the air fryer basket with foil or a paper towel to make cleanup easier.
- Lay 2-3 slices of bacon in the basket.
- Cook the bacon at 400°F (200°C) for 5-7 minutes, or until crispy.
Sausages
Sausages are another popular breakfast food that can be cooked to perfection in an air fryer. Here’s a simple recipe:
- Place 2-3 sausages in the air fryer basket.
- Cook the sausages at 400°F (200°C) for 5-7 minutes, or until browned and cooked through.
More Advanced Air Fryer Breakfast Recipes
Now that you’ve mastered the basics, it’s time to move on to some more advanced air fryer breakfast recipes.
Breakfast Burrito
A breakfast burrito is a filling and delicious breakfast option that can be made in an air fryer. Here’s a recipe to try:
- Scramble 2-3 eggs in a bowl and set them aside.
- Cook 2-3 slices of bacon in the air fryer until crispy. Chop the bacon into small pieces and set it aside.
- Add 1/2 cup of frozen hash browns to the air fryer basket. Cook the hash browns at 400°F (200°C) for 5-7 minutes, or until crispy.
- Warm a tortilla in the air fryer for 30-60 seconds.
- Assemble the burrito by filling the tortilla with scrambled eggs, crispy bacon, and hash browns.
Cinnamon Rolls
Yes, you can even make cinnamon rolls in an air fryer. Here’s a recipe to try:
- Roll out a can of cinnamon roll dough and cut it into 4-6 equal pieces.
- Place the cinnamon rolls in the air fryer basket, leaving a little space between each roll.
- Cook the cinnamon rolls at 375°F (190°C) for 5-7 minutes, or until golden brown.
Quiche
Quiche is a versatile breakfast dish that can be made in an air fryer. Here’s a recipe to try:
- Whisk together 2-3 eggs, 1/2 cup of milk, and a pinch of salt and pepper in a bowl.
- Add 1/2 cup of diced ham and 1/2 cup of shredded cheese to the egg mixture. Stir to combine.
- Pour the egg mixture into a greased air fryer basket.
- Cook the quiche at 300°F (150°C) for 10-12 minutes, or until the eggs are set.

How do I clean my air fryer after cooking breakfast?
Cleaning your air fryer after cooking breakfast is a breeze. Start by unplugging the appliance and letting it cool down completely. Then, remove the basket and pan and wash them in warm soapy water. Use a soft sponge or brush to remove any food residue and stains.
For tougher stains, you can mix equal parts water and white vinegar in the air fryer basket and let it soak for 30 minutes. Then, scrub the basket with a soft sponge and rinse with warm water. Dry the basket and pan thoroughly before storing them in a dry place. Regular cleaning will help maintain your air fryer’s performance and prevent bacterial growth.
